Application Of Real-time Elastography And Fibro Scan In Evaluation Of Liver Fibrosis

Objective China is the hardest hit by chronic hepatitis B.Every year,hundreds of thousands of patients die from hepatitis B and related diseases.It can be transmitted through various routes such as maternal and child,blood products and application of blood,sexual contact,and damaged skin mucosa.Chronic hepatitis B has become a public health problem in China that cannot be ignored.Hepatic fibrosis is one of the basic pathological changes of hepatitis B.Its main pathological features are intrahepatic connective tissue hyperplasia and abnormal deposition of extracellular matrix.Liver fibrosis is a pathological consequence of various chronic damages and inflammations such as viruses,various autoimmune diseases,and cholestatic metabolic diseases.Part of patients with liver fibrosis can progress to cirrhosis and liver cancer.This is because extensively proliferating fibrous tissue will regenerate nodules to form pseudolobules,and liver fibrosis is difficult to reverse.However,early liver fibrosis lesions have a certain degree of reversibility.Therefore,early diagnosis and early treatment have important clinical significance for controlling liver fibrosis and preventing the deterioration of lesions.The current liver biopsy is still the“gold standard”for identifying the stage of liver fibrosis,however,because of its invasiveness and high fees,a large number of patients are difficult to accept,and the amount of liver tissue samples taken during each liver biopsy is limited,plus physician reading.Subjective influence,thus having certain limitations and subjectivity.In recent years,with the rapid development of imaging technology,elastography has become a non-invasive new technology for evaluating liver stiffness and is gradually being applied to clinical research.Currently used in clinical ultrasound elastography mainly include real-time tissue elastography(RTE),transient elastography(FibroScan,FS),real-time shear wave elastography(SWE),and acoustic radiation.Force pulse elastography(ARFI),etc.This article aims to investigate the value of RTE and FS in the evaluation of liver fibrosis in patients with chronichepatitis B.Methods The observation group was selected as 210 patients with chronic hepatitis B,and another 120 healthy volunteers in the control group.Ultrasound RTE and FS were performed on two groups of subjects using a Hitachi HI Vision Preims color Doppler ultrasound system equipped with RTE technology and a FibroScan 502 ultrasound diagnostic instrument manufactured by Echosens,France.The observation group was finally punctured.Biopsy to determine the degree of liver fibrosis.The liver fibrosis index(LF Index)and liver stiffness value(LSM)of the two groups were compared,and the relationship between RTE,FS and liver fibrosis was analyzed.Results The different of MEAN,SD,COMP,SKEW and AREA value of the control group and the observation group were significant(P<0.05).In the observation group,the MEAN,SD,COMP,SKEW,and AREA values of the F0 patients were not significantly different from those of the control group(P>0.05).The MEAN,SD,COMP,SKEW and AREA levels showed an increasing trend with the increase of liver fibrosis stage(F0 phase <F1 phase <F2 phase <F3 phase <F4 phase).The LF Index and LSM values of the control group and the observation group were significantly different(P<0.05),Index and LSM values increased with the increase of liver fibrosis stage.Correlation analysis showed that LF Index,LSM and liver fibrosis stage were positively correlated(P<0.05).Taking the F2 phase as the demarcation point,the area under the ROC curve(AUC value)of the LF Index and the LSM value respectively were 0.892(95% CI:0.758~0.925)and 0.905(95% CI:0.815~0.992).Taking the F3 phase as the demarcation point,the AUC values of the LF Index and the LSM value respectively were 0.886(95% CI:0.826~0.964)and 0.872(95% CI:0.814~0.910).Conclusion Both ultrasound RTE and FS can effectively evaluate the degree of liver fibrosis in patients with chronic hepatitis B.The evaluation of liver fibrosis is equivalent,and the advantages of non-invasive and rapid between two inspection methods.
